Nicolas Peyraube is a scholar working on Earth-Surface Processes, Geochemistry and Petrology and Environmental Engineering. According to data from OpenAlex, Nicolas Peyraube has authored 20 papers receiving a total of 272 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Earth-Surface Processes, 10 papers in Geochemistry and Petrology and 7 papers in Environmental Engineering. Recurrent topics in Nicolas Peyraube’s work include Karst Systems and Hydrogeology (13 papers), Groundwater and Isotope Geochemistry (10 papers) and Groundwater and Watershed Analysis (4 papers). Nicolas Peyraube is often cited by papers focused on Karst Systems and Hydrogeology (13 papers), Groundwater and Isotope Geochemistry (10 papers) and Groundwater and Watershed Analysis (4 papers). Nicolas Peyraube collaborates with scholars based in France, Philippines and Syria. Nicolas Peyraube's co-authors include Roland Lastennet, A. Denis, Philippe Malaurent, Alain Denis, Philippe Le Coustumer, Christophe Emblanch, Jean‐Luc Probst, Anne Probst, Jean‐Baptiste Charlier and Stéphane Binet and has published in prestigious journals such as Geochimica et Cosmochimica Acta, The Science of The Total Environment and Journal of Hydrology.
